Are Baazar Style Retail Ltd latest results good or bad?

Baazar Style Retail Ltd's latest Q3 FY26 results show mixed performance: while revenue increased by 13.33% year-on-year, net profit fell by 63.18% from the previous quarter, raising concerns about profitability despite improved operational efficiency. The company's high debt-to-equity ratio and below-benchmark capital efficiency metrics suggest ongoing challenges ahead.
Baazar Style Retail Ltd's latest financial results for Q3 FY26 present a mixed picture. The company reported a net profit of ₹18.96 crores, reflecting a significant decline of 63.18% compared to the previous quarter, which raises concerns about its profitability amidst rising costs. In contrast, revenue for the same quarter stood at ₹466.48 crores, marking a year-on-year increase of 13.33%, although it showed a sequential decline of 12.26% from the previous quarter. This decline in revenue can be attributed to typical seasonality in the retail sector, particularly following a festive quarter which usually sees higher sales.
The operating margin improved to 19.16%, up from 13.0% in Q2 FY26, indicating enhanced operational efficiency and better cost management. However, the profit after tax (PAT) margin decreased to 4.06% from 9.68% in the previous quarter, highlighting the impact of increased depreciation and interest expenses on overall profitability. On a broader scale, the company achieved a nine-month revenue growth of 38.15% year-on-year, underscoring its ability to expand its retail footprint effectively. However, the sharp decline in net profit raises questions about the sustainability of this growth, particularly given the elevated fixed costs associated with its capital-intensive business model. Furthermore, Baazar Style Retail's capital efficiency metrics, such as return on capital employed (ROCE) and return on equity (ROE), remain below industry benchmarks, suggesting challenges in optimizing capital deployment. The company's debt-to-equity ratio of 1.81 indicates a higher level of leverage, which could amplify both risks and opportunities moving forward. Overall, Baazar Style Retail Ltd's latest results reflect a complex operational landscape, with strong revenue growth tempered by significant challenges in profitability and capital efficiency. Following these results, the company experienced an adjustment in its evaluation, indicating a need for careful monitoring of its financial health and operational execution in the coming quarters.
